| In 1970-1978 she was owned by James S. Byrn (MO), Vancouver BC Canada. In 1979-2001 she was owned by Canadian Occidental Petroleum Ltd., Calgary AB Canada. In 2003-2004 she was owned by Nexen Inc., Calgary AB Canada. In 2012-2014 she was owned by Canexus Chemicals Canada Ltd., Calgary AB Canada. In 2017-2025 she was owned by Kortech Marine Ltd., Edmonton AB Canada. |
